Does anybody out there have any idea as to what pricing is currently for Oakley's RX lenses? I was looking over the prices at a site called sportsvisionbend.com I use as a reference to see what type of Oakley RX lenses were available and their prices seemed to have jumped tremendously. I know that I personally paid $180 for clear RX with A/R and $250 for polarized RX lenses as of November last year, which was in line with what Sports Vision Bend listed on their site. But now they're listing $315 for polarized lenses which is quite steep. I had been sitting here casually thinking about prescriptioning some of my Square Wire 2.0s to have something more dressy than my prescriptioned Juliets, but $315 is making me do double takes. Did Oakley raise prices on their RX lenses?
